Megosztás a következőn keresztül:


az iot ops schema

Feljegyzés

Ez a hivatkozás az Azure CLI azure-iot-ops bővítményének része (2.53.0-s vagy újabb verzió). A bővítmény automatikusan telepíti az az iot ops sémaparancs első futtatásakor. További információ a bővítményekről.

Ez a parancscsoport előzetes verzióban és fejlesztés alatt áll. Referencia- és támogatási szintek: https://aka.ms/CLI_refstatus

Séma- és beállításjegyzék-kezelés.

A sémák olyan dokumentumok, amelyek adatokat írnak le a feldolgozás és a környezetualizáció engedélyezéséhez. Az üzenetsémák az üzenet formátumát és tartalmát írják le. A sémák létrehozásához és kezeléséhez sémaregisztrációs adatbázis szükséges.

Parancsok

Name Description Típus Állapot
az iot ops schema create

Séma létrehozása sémaregisztrációs adatbázison belül.

Mellék Előnézet
az iot ops schema delete

Célséma törlése a sémaregisztrációs adatbázisban.

Mellék Előnézet
az iot ops schema list

Sémajegyzék sémáinak listázása.

Mellék Előnézet
az iot ops schema registry

Sémaregisztrációs adatbázis kezelése.

Mellék Előnézet
az iot ops schema registry create

Hozzon létre egy sémaregisztrációs adatbázist.

Mellék Előnézet
az iot ops schema registry delete

Törölje a célséma-beállításjegyzéket.

Mellék Előnézet
az iot ops schema registry list

Sémaregisztrációs adatbázisok listázása egy erőforráscsoportban vagy előfizetésben.

Mellék Előnézet
az iot ops schema registry show

Sémaregisztrációs adatbázis részleteinek megjelenítése.

Mellék Előnézet
az iot ops schema show

Séma részleteinek megjelenítése egy sémaregisztrációs adatbázisban.

Mellék Előnézet
az iot ops schema show-dataflow-refs

Az adatfolyamokhoz használt sémahivatkozások megjelenítése.

Mellék Kísérleti
az iot ops schema version

Sémaverzió-kezelés.

Mellék Előnézet
az iot ops schema version add

Sémaverzió hozzáadása sémához.

Mellék Előnézet
az iot ops schema version list

Egy adott séma sémaverzióinak listázása.

Mellék Előnézet
az iot ops schema version remove

Távolítsa el a célséma verzióját.

Mellék Előnézet
az iot ops schema version show

Sémaverzió részleteinek megjelenítése.

Mellék Előnézet

az iot ops schema create

Előnézet

Az "iot ops schema" parancscsoport előzetes verzióban és fejlesztés alatt áll. Referencia- és támogatási szintek: https://aka.ms/CLI_refstatus

Séma létrehozása sémaregisztrációs adatbázison belül.

Ehhez a művelethez előre létrehozott sémaregisztrációs adatbázisra van szükség, és hozzá fog adni egy sémaverziót. A séma létrehozásához és egy verzió hozzáadásához a társított tárfióknak engedélyeznie kell a nyilvános hálózati hozzáférést. A delta fájlformátumról további információt a aka.ms/lakehouse-delta-sample talál.

az iot ops schema create --format {delta, json}
                         --name
                         --registry
                         --resource-group
                         --type {message}
                         --vc
                         [--desc]
                         [--display-name]
                         [--vd]
                         [--ver]

Példák

Hozzon létre egy "myschema" nevű sémát a "myregistry" beállításjegyzékben minimális bemenetekkel. A séma 1. verziója a fájltartalommal jön létre ehhez a sémához.

az iot ops schema create -n myschema -g myresourcegroup --registry myregistry --format json --type message --version-content myschema.json

Hozzon létre egy "myschema" nevű sémát további testreszabással. A séma 14-es verziója létrejön ehhez a sémához. A beágyazott tartalom egy bash szintaxisbeli példa. További példákért lásd: https://aka.ms/inline-json-examples

az iot ops schema create -n myschema -g myresourcegroup --registry myregistry --format delta --type message --desc "Schema for Assets" --display-name myassetschema --version-content '{"hello": "world"}' --ver 14 --vd "14th version"

Kötelező paraméterek

--format

Sémaformátum.

Elfogadott értékek: delta, json
--name -n

Séma neve.

--registry

Sémaregisztrációs adatbázis neve.

--resource-group -g

Az erőforráscsoport neve. Az alapértelmezett csoportot a az configure --defaults group=<name>használatával konfigurálhatja.

--type

Sématípus.

Elfogadott értékek: message
--vc --version-content

A verziót tartalmazó vagy beágyazott tartalmat tartalmazó fájl elérési útja.

Opcionális paraméterek

--desc

A séma leírása.

--display-name

A séma megjelenítendő neve.

--vd --version-desc

A verzió leírása.

--ver --version

Sémaverzió neve.

Alapértelmezett érték: 1
Globális paraméterek
--debug

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.

--help -h

Jelenítse meg ezt a súgóüzenetet, és lépjen ki.

--only-show-errors

Csak a hibák megjelenítése, a figyelmeztetések mellőzése.

--output -o

Kimeneti formátum.

Elfogadott értékek: json, jsonc, none, table, tsv, yaml, yamlc
Alapértelmezett érték: json
--query

J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.

--subscription

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ID: .

--verbose

A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.

az iot ops schema delete

Előnézet

Az "iot ops schema" parancscsoport előzetes verzióban és fejlesztés alatt áll. Referencia- és támogatási szintek: https://aka.ms/CLI_refstatus

Célséma törlése a sémaregisztrációs adatbázisban.

az iot ops schema delete --name
                         --registry
                         --resource-group
                         [--yes {false, true}]

Példák

Töröljön egy célséma "myschema" elemét a sémaregisztrációs adatbázis "myregistry" beállításjegyzékében.

az iot ops schema delete --name myschema --registry myregistry -g myresourcegroup

Kötelező paraméterek

--name -n

Séma neve.

--registry

Sémaregisztrációs adatbázis neve.

--resource-group -g

Az erőforráscsoport neve. Az alapértelmezett csoportot a az configure --defaults group=<name>használatával konfigurálhatja.

Opcionális paraméterek

--yes -y

Erősítse meg a(z) [y] es elemet, és ne adjon meg egy kérést. Ci- és automatizálási forgatókönyvekben hasznos.

Elfogadott értékek: false, true
Globális paraméterek
--debug

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.

--help -h

Jelenítse meg ezt a súgóüzenetet, és lépjen ki.

--only-show-errors

Csak a hibák megjelenítése, a figyelmeztetések mellőzése.

--output -o

Kimeneti formátum.

Elfogadott értékek: json, jsonc, none, table, tsv, yaml, yamlc
Alapértelmezett érték: json
--query

J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.

--subscription

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ID: .

--verbose

A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.

az iot ops schema list

Előnézet

Az "iot ops schema" parancscsoport előzetes verzióban és fejlesztés alatt áll. Referencia- és támogatási szintek: https://aka.ms/CLI_refstatus

Sémajegyzék sémáinak listázása.

az iot ops schema list --registry
                       --resource-group

Példák

A sémaregisztrációs adatbázisok listája a "myregistry" sémaregisztrációs adatbázisban.

az iot ops schema list -g myresourcegroup --registry myregistry

Kötelező paraméterek

--registry

Sémaregisztrációs adatbázis neve.

--resource-group -g

Az erőforráscsoport neve. Az alapértelmezett csoportot a az configure --defaults group=<name>használatával konfigurálhatja.

Globális paraméterek
--debug

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.

--help -h

Jelenítse meg ezt a súgóüzenetet, és lépjen ki.

--only-show-errors

Csak a hibák megjelenítése, a figyelmeztetések mellőzése.

--output -o

Kimeneti formátum.

Elfogadott értékek: json, jsonc, none, table, tsv, yaml, yamlc
Alapértelmezett érték: json
--query

J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.

--subscription

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ID: .

--verbose

A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.

az iot ops schema show

Előnézet

Az "iot ops schema" parancscsoport előzetes verzióban és fejlesztés alatt áll. Referencia- és támogatási szintek: https://aka.ms/CLI_refstatus

Séma részleteinek megjelenítése egy sémaregisztrációs adatbázisban.

az iot ops schema show --name
                       --registry
                       --resource-group

Példák

A "myregistry" sémaregisztrációs adatbázison belül a "myschema" célséma részleteinek megjelenítése.

az iot ops schema show --name myschema --registry myregistry -g myresourcegroup

Kötelező paraméterek

--name -n

Séma neve.

--registry

Sémaregisztrációs adatbázis neve.

--resource-group -g

Az erőforráscsoport neve. Az alapértelmezett csoportot a az configure --defaults group=<name>használatával konfigurálhatja.

Globális paraméterek
--debug

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.

--help -h

Jelenítse meg ezt a súgóüzenetet, és lépjen ki.

--only-show-errors

Csak a hibák megjelenítése, a figyelmeztetések mellőzése.

--output -o

Kimeneti formátum.

Elfogadott értékek: json, jsonc, none, table, tsv, yaml, yamlc
Alapértelmezett érték: json
--query

J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.

--subscription

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ID: .

--verbose

A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.

az iot ops schema show-dataflow-refs

Kísérleti

Ez a parancs kísérleti és fejlesztés alatt áll. Referencia- és támogatási szintek: https://aka.ms/CLI_refstatus

Az adatfolyamokhoz használt sémahivatkozások megjelenítése.

az iot ops schema show-dataflow-refs --registry
                                     --resource-group
                                     [--latest {false, true}]
                                     [--schema]
                                     [--ver]

Példák

Sémahivatkozás megjelenítése a séma "myschema" és az 1. verzió esetében.

az iot ops schema show-dataflow-refs --version 1 --schema myschema --registry myregistry -g myresourcegroup

A séma "myschema" összes verziójára vonatkozó sémahivatkozás megjelenítése.

az iot ops schema show-dataflow-refs --schema myschema --registry myregistry -g myresourcegroup

A sémahivatkozás megjelenítése az összes verzióra és sémára a sémaregisztrációs adatbázis "myregistry" beállításjegyzékében.

az iot ops schema show-dataflow-refs --registry myregistry -g myresourcegroup

A sémahivatkozás megjelenítése az összes sémához, de csak a sémaregisztrációs adatbázis legújabb verzióihoz (myregistry).

az iot ops schema show-dataflow-refs --registry myregistry -g myresourcegroup --latest

Kötelező paraméterek

--registry

Sémaregisztrációs adatbázis neve.

--resource-group -g

Az erőforráscsoport neve. Az alapértelmezett csoportot a az configure --defaults group=<name>használatával konfigurálhatja.

Opcionális paraméterek

--latest

Csak a legújabb verzió(ka)t jeleníti meg.

Elfogadott értékek: false, true
--schema

Séma neve. A --version használata esetén kötelező.

--ver --version

Sémaverzió neve. Ha a használatban van, a rendszer figyelmen kívül hagyja a --latest értéket.

Globális paraméterek
--debug

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.

--help -h

Jelenítse meg ezt a súgóüzenetet, és lépjen ki.

--only-show-errors

Csak a hibák megjelenítése, a figyelmeztetések mellőzése.

--output -o

Kimeneti formátum.

Elfogadott értékek: json, jsonc, none, table, tsv, yaml, yamlc
Alapértelmezett érték: json
--query

J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.

--subscription

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ID: .

--verbose

A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.